Ground Level Deck Construction in Fairfield County, CT
Ground level deck construction services provide homeowners with the opportunity to create functional outdoor spaces directly accessible from their property’s ground level. These projects typically involve building new decks or expanding existing ones, often designed for outdoor dining, relaxing, or entertaining. Property owners usually want to understand the scope of customization options, such as materials, size, and layout, as well as the preparation involved and how the new deck will integrate with existing landscaping or structures.
Before requesting ground level deck construction, homeowners should consider factors like the intended use of the space, local building codes, and any necessary permits. It’s also helpful to think about the site conditions, including ground stability and drainage, to ensure a durable and safe structure. Clear communication about design preferences and property specifics can help facilitate a smooth planning process for a deck that enhances outdoor living areas.

Ground Level Deck Construction Questions
What is a ground level deck? A ground level deck is a flat, outdoor platform built close to the ground, providing a space for relaxation and entertainment directly on the property.
What materials are commonly used for ground level decks? Common materials include pressure-treated wood, composite decking, and natural stone, chosen for durability and aesthetic appeal.
Are ground level decks suitable for small yards? Yes, they are often ideal for smaller outdoor spaces, offering a functional area without overwhelming the yard.
What should property owners consider before building a ground level deck? Factors include the terrain, local building codes, drainage, and how the deck will complement existing outdoor features.
